The 16th Annual International Schools’ Athletic Championship (ISAC) 2016 is scheduled to be held on the 4th, 5th and 6th of March at the Mahinda Rajapakse Stadium, Diyagama from 8:00 am to 6:00pm each day.

Over 3,000 athletes from 24 international schools will compete in 130 events. The age groups range from under 7 to under 20 for both boys and girls. During the 15 years’ existence of the ISAC , the standard of Athletics among TISSL affiliated International Schools have progressed to an extent where they can produce skilled, professional athletes to represent Sri Lanka at competitive Track and Field Athletic Championship events abroad.

300 officials are said to be conducting the competition under the rules of the Amateur Athletic Association of Sri Lanka. This event has been fully computerized with web based entries for participants and well-wishers to instantly access results and scores over the web through the following website: https://isac.lyceum.lk/. All athletes participating at the ISAC 2016 will carry a common Identity Card issued by TISSL, the governing body coordinating International schools in Sri Lanka.

This event is considered to be the most important co-curricular event in the calendar of all international schools. Each school awaits the opportunity to go head on with one another as they battle out to win the championship title.

Lyceum International School has been hosting this prestigious event over the years, which is the brainchild of the Founder late Mr. R.I.T. Alles. Lyceum took over the reins from Gateway College in 2004 and continued hosting the event every 3 years. At the closing ceremony of ISAC 2015 once again Lyceum took over to serve as the Official Organizer of ISAC- 2016.

The opening ceremony on the 4th of March, and the closing ceremony on the 6th of March will be graced by the Chief Guest for this year, Mr. Arjuna Ranatunga, Hon. Minister of Ports and Shipping.
